Clancy, Puck Make Good in Canada

Studio B Prods. has completed deals with Knowledge Network and SCN, two Canadian educational TV networks, for the animated short CLANCY WITH THE PUCK. Both broadcasters will air the short in high rotation, beginning Dec. 1, 2007. In addition, leading independent Canadian publisher Raincoast Books has shipped the hardcover picture book of the same name, which is packaged with a DVD of the film, into Canada and the U.S.

Created by Chris Mizzoni, CLANCY WITH THE PUCK features the hapless-but-heroic Clancy, who has everything that fans love. When his team has the chance to win the hearts of hometown fans and take home the Stanley Cup, it's all up to Clancy to score the winning goal. The short is narrated by legendary hockey commentator Bob Cole, whose HOCKEY NIGHT IN CANADA play-by-play is heard by millions of hockey fans every week.

Knowledge Network is British Columbia's public educational broadcaster and delivers compelling, in-depth documentaries, nonviolent, educational children's programming, and unique and entertaining drama to all British Columbians. Funded by the provincial government and more than 25,000 individual donors, it produces over 50 hours of original programming per year.

SCN is Saskatchewan's Storyteller, reaching 91% of Saskatchewan's households. As the province's public educational broadcaster, SCN delivers commercial-free stories on cable, wireless, digital and satellite television networks.
